KDDI has decided to introduce a new rate plan with a monthly data usage of 20 gigabytes and 2480 yen per month.

In response to the government's request for price cuts, NTT DoCoMo and Softbank have announced that they will introduce a monthly rate plan of 2980 yen for the same 20 GB, and price competition between major companies has become fierce.

According to the people concerned, KDDI has decided to introduce a new rate plan of 2480 yen per month for 20 gigabytes to its mainstay au.



This amount is added to the charges for voice calls and additional data usage so that the actual charges can be set according to the usage of the user.



It supports not only 4G but also the new communication standard 5G, and by dedicating procedures such as application to online only, we will officially announce it tomorrow along with the price reduction of the large capacity rate plan.
